Each Shotwell import (whether manual or via auto-import) creates a fresh
set of events.  So if an import includes a photo taken on May 4, and
then a following import includes another photo taken on May 4, then you
will see May 4 twice in the sidebar.  (You can easily merge these events
if you like.)

This behavior was originally by design.  We've come to feel that it's
more confusing than helpful, and that it would be better if imported
photos were placed into existing events so that each day would only
appear once.  This ticket tracks this issue upstream:
